Functions, Types, and New Technologies Used in Pharmaceutical Packaging

Pharmaceutical packaging companies are making sure that they are packaging their pharmaceutical products well to ensure the effectiveness and safety of it. Packaging in its sense, are the different components that surround the pharmaceutical product from the production time up to the time it is used.

It refers to the process of designing, evaluating, and producing packages that are used even on biotechnology products.

The Functions of Pharmaceutical Packaging:

Protects the pharmaceutical products from physical damages and contamination that can alter the properties of the pharmaceutical products.

It carries the identification and information of the pharmaceutical product.

It enhances anti-counterfeiting and child resistance or tamper evident.

The Importance of Pharmaceutical Packaging:

Promotion: It serves as a promotional product that can catch the attention of people when purchasing the pharmaceutical products.

Directions of Use: In the package, it must be convenient enough when opening, handling, and usage for the benefit of the consumers.

Protection: It hinders spoilage, breakage, leakage of the contents of pharmaceutical products.

Identification: It helps in identifying which product is which and avoid confusion when mixing it altogether inside a tertiary packaging.

Types of Pharmaceutical Packaging:

Primary

This is the material that first touches and encloses the pharmaceutical product.

Ex: bottles, blister packs, aerosol spray can, etc.

Secondary

This packaging groups the primary package altogether. This is what enfolds the primary packaging.

Ex: cartons, boxes

Tertiary

This is used to carry all the products, especially when handling and shipping.

Ex: edge protector, barrel, container, etc.

Often, these packages are tested first to see its durability through:

Revolving drum test
Drop test
Inclined impact test
Vibration test
Shock test

New Technologies in the Pharmaceutical Packaging:

Automation in the quality control of the pharmaceutical packaging is abundant and will continue to do so in the years to come, as it is the biggest investment that Pharmaceutical packaging companies can invest in.

Childproof containers and even senior-friendly pharmaceutical packaging will be enhanced to give safety measures to both children and older people. As well as the easy access to their medications.

Pharmaceutical packaging companies are improving their supply-chain security measures to avoid counterfeiting issues.

Since pharmaceutical products are being shipped globally, Pharmaceutical packaging companies make sure that it can withstand different weather and climate conditions to avoid damage to the products.
